Nemours Mobile Clinic – Project Information
The Nemours Mobile Clinic is a project of the infectious disease department of Nemours Children’s Hospital to provide free preventive care to uninsured children in underserved neighborhoods. The pilot project will take place on Saturdays (about 9am – 1pm) in January and February. Many children have missed their normal pediatric well checks and have fallen behind in vaccines due to COVID-19. Our goal is to see 20 children at each clinic to get them up-to-date on well checks and vaccinations. We have a fully-stocked exam room in a Nemours van that we can bring to our partner organizations in order to see children in locations familiar and convenient for them and their families. The clinic is fully run by volunteer Nemours physicians, residents, child-life specialists, and students.
